Star Wars in Concert

Earlier this month John and I attend Star Wars in Concert at Nationwide Arena. It is a concert where a live orchestra and chorus perform music (composed by John Williams) from the six Star War films while a HUGE LED screen is displaying clips of the films. The show was hosted by Anthony Daniels, who was C-3PO in the films. He did quote on of his own lines in C-3PO's voice while showing his gold vest (his character was a gold-colored android). It was a fabulous concert! There were props from the films at different locations around the arena too.
